The Venetian company & egrave; internationally known for its product catalog, made by renowned designers all over the world. An exclusive Made in Italy brand that starts its business; in 1976, thanks to the entrepreneur Eugenio Perazza. From that moment on Magis has always distinguished its accessories with a unique and unparalleled style. A bulwark of Italian design, winner of innumerable prizes and awards. The Italian brand & egrave; unquestionably part of the history of design in recent decades, so much so as to be part of numerous contemporary museum collections, such as the Center Georges Pompidou in Paris, the Stedelijk Museum in Amsterdam, the Victoria and Albert Museum in London or in New York at the renowned MoMA. p> The countless and profitable collaborations have made Magis a guarantee of quality & agrave; and innovation always in constant change. Like the products designed by Phlippe Starck strong>, creations that have become icons of trendy furniture. The French architect for Magis has created the Zartan collection of chairs, to be chosen in the different versions available or the S.S.S.S. Sweet Stainless Steel Stool, designed together with Luigi Barei. The structure is totally in stainless steel and the height is adjustable, thanks to the presence of a gas piston. Phlippe Starck with the Chien Savant experiments, playing with shapes and lines, creating a writing table for children with a polyethylene seat printed using the technique called rotational molding. P> The model of Bunky bunk bed strong>, the original Rock doorstop or the Dish Doctor dish rack strong> are some of the articles made by the famous Australian designer Marc Newson. The extensive Magis product catalog includes several complements made by Naoto Fukasawa, which characterizes their work by combining the forms linked to an object in its essential functionalities. Cos & igrave; born the extendable tables of the Daja-vu line, from the structure in polished extruded aluminum while the horizontal shelf is used; in HPL. The library module with Cosino open shelves can be used; be modular, stackable and approachable, giving dynamism to the living context in which it is integrated. p> Complements that define the space in a versatile way, with new decorative concepts. Like the production of Stefano Giovannoni that for Magis offers linear and essential geometries, declined in the Paso Doble collection that includes chairs, stools, chaise longues and armchairs. Or the originality is; of the Boogie Woogie strong> bookcase that breaks up the space, with harmonious wavy shapes. p> The products of the Ligurian architect not only include 'furniture but revisit, in an ironic and modern, objects of common use. For example the model of broom Mag & agrave; made of polypropylene and fiberglass with polyester bristles, equipped with spare accessories and hook for wall mounting. Winner of the Compasso d'Oro award three times; Enzo Mari strong> that for the Italian brand designs the Erettio umbrella stand strong>, recalling the classical art of ancient Greece. Revisited through the use of experimental materials, such as injection-molded polypropylene fiber. The traditional staticit & agrave; of the silent servant relives thanks to Pronto, the coat hanger is equipped with a practical glove box. The management of space becomes the protagonist of the living furniture with Dove, the basket made of glossy SAN printed, stackable and available with small wheels, designed by the eclectic Andries & amp; Hiroko Van Onck.
